Benefits of Go Markets and XGLOBAL Markets Compared
Go Markets offers a minimum deposit of $1 while XGLOBAL Markets offers a $500 minimum deposit.
Why smaller minimum deposits are good and how Go Markets and XGLOBAL Markets compare
The main reason is that you should only deposit what you can afford. If you you have a lower budget, the broker that offers the lowest deposit option will be more attractive. The other reason is because when speculating on riskier but potentially more rewarding financial instruments you should look to speculate with only a small percentage of your allocated trading funds. Don't let a higher minimum deposit totally put you off a broker, look at the overall trading features you are getting from the trading platform. Often a high minimum deposit gives greater choice in the financial assets and trading platform research features.

Go Markets vs XGLOBAL Markets - Headquarters And Year Of Founding
Go Markets was founded in 2009 and has its headquaters in Australia.
XGLOBAL Markets was founded in 2008 and has its headquaters in Cyprus.

Go Markets vs XGLOBAL Markets - Regulation And Licencing In More Detail
Go Markets is regulated by Australian Securities and Investment Commission (ASIC).
XGLOBAL Markets is regulated by Cyprus Securities and Exchange Commission (CySEC).

Compare Go Markets vs XGLOBAL Markets Commission And Fees
Go Markets and XGLOBAL Markets are online broker platforms, and most online brokerages charge lower fees than traditional brokerages tend to bill. The cause of this is that the companies of online brokerages are scaled better. In other words, an internet broker is not necessarily influenced by the amount of customers they have.
But this does not mean that online brokers don't charge any fees. They charge fees of varying rates for various services to make money. There are primarily 3 types of fees for this purpose.
The first sort of fees to look out for are trading charges. Whenever you make an actual trade, like purchasing a stock or an ETF, you are billed trading charges. In such cases, you are paying a spread, financing rate, or a commission. The sorts of trading fees and the rates differ from broker to broker.
Commissions can be fixed or dependent on the traded quantity. On the flip side, a spread denotes the difference between the buying and selling cost. Funding or overnight rates are those that are billed when you maintain a leveraged position for longer than daily.
Aside from trading charges, online agents also bill non-trading fees. These are determined by the actions you undertake on your account. They are billed for operations like depositing cash, not investing for long periods, or withdrawals.
